Jobs for Medical/Clinical Assistant Grads in Alaska
In this state, there are 2,570 people employed in jobs related to a Medical/Clinical Assistant degree, compared to 1,023,180 nationwide.
Wages for Medical/Clinical Assistant Jobs in Alaska
In this state, Medical/Clinical Assistant grads earn an average of $58,766. Nationwide, they make an average of $65,640.
